🎨 Tape Like a Pro, Paint Like a Boss!
The ScotchBlue Painters Tape Applicator streamlines paint prep with a 1.41-inch wide, 20-yard tape roll applied in one continuous strip. Featuring a sharp blade for straight cuts and an ergonomic circular grip, it ensures precise, comfortable application on trim, windows, and door frames. The UV- and moisture-resistant tape works indoors and outdoors, made sustainably with renewable materials and post-consumer waste. Easy to reload and removes cleanly after up to 14 days, this semi-automatic hand-powered tool is a must-have for efficient, professional painting projects.

Straight lines!!!
I had to paint our hallway woodwork an that had 5 door ways off it and I knew my ability to run masking tape around each door frame and skirting board would be a challenge. I saw this and did some research - watching a few YouTube reviews and it was a mixed result. I decided to take the plunge and ordered it along with ScotchBlue Multi-Surface Premium Masking Tape, 36 mm x 41 m, 4 Rolls/Case - the roll that's supplied barely did one door frame but these fitted the applicator and worked very well! Would I recommend this to family and or friends - YES Is it difficult to use - NO Keep the edge on your door frame/floor etc and make sure there are no lumps of paint that will push it out and you'll mask the door frame in a few minutes - it is so simple to use and the results are fantastic. I left the masking tape on for 3 days - 2 undercoats and 2 top coats - no bleed through or creeping under the edges and very straight lines.

Glorified Tape Dispenser
This product has over 2600 reviews, mostly five stars, which will no doubtedly lead people to buy it, however, it must be important to note that this is either an error, as in, the previous item listed on this page has been swapped out as often seen, or it’s from international reviews which again, may serve no purpose to this product. Therefore the reality of this product is that it is useless, and not fit for its intended purposes. It’s a big bulky piece of plastic with two fabric pads, and two wheels. The item does not glide along the roof or floor as intended, it just clunks and bangs awkwardly. The tape doesn’t cut from the dispenser in any easy fashion, so you have to rip it off by hand or pull the unit from the wall/floor, separating the tape in any event…. If you manage to get it to roll along the wall or floor for any moment in time, it isn’t level, as the tape doesn’t form part of the actual unit, it just sits independently shaking around in its basket and your guided by the feet… therefore it’s no different than doing it by hand? As such, all it really is, is a tape dispenser for frog tape… I had hoped this would save some time during some decorating work, but unless your pairing the Sistine Chapel, I’ve realised life is too short, and some slight lines out of place on my roof by hand isn’t the end of the world. There is a competitor of this out there, however that’s again over £60, and approx £80 with delivery, albeit it does look like that would work, again, I doubt anyone but you would notice your slight imperfections if you used frog tape by hand.
